Understanding Private Mental Health Diagnosis
Private mental health diagnosis describes the procedure of evaluating mental health conditions by certified professionals in a private practice setting. This can include psychologists, psychiatrists, clinical social employees, and accredited therapists. Such services often guarantee a higher level of confidentiality and individualized care than might be discovered in public health care systems.
Why Consider a Private Diagnosis?
There are numerous factors why individuals might choose to pursue a private mental health diagnosis:
Reduced Wait Times: Public healthcare systems frequently have long waiting lists, especially for expert evaluations. Private services provide quicker access to necessary assessments.
Personalized Attention: In a private mental health Diagnosis Near me setting, individuals might experience more individually time with their practitioners, permitting a more tailored method to their mental health concerns.
Confidentiality and Comfort: Those who look for a private diagnosis may feel more comfy discussing delicate problems with someone in a private practice, reducing potential stigma related to mental healthcare.
Comprehensive Assessments: Many private professionals provide holistic assessments that consist of a full assessment of mental, physical, and social elements adding to the client's condition.
How to Find Private Mental Health Diagnosis Services Near You
Discovering private mental health services can feel daunting, however various resources can help improve the procedure. Here's a detailed guide to finding these service providers:
Step-by-Step Guide
Online Research: Start by conducting online searches using terms like "private mental health diagnostic services near me" or "psychologists in [your area]" Sites such as Psychology Today enable you to filter based on specializeds and places.
Seek Advice From with Medical Professionals: Speak with your main care doctor or any other relied on physician. They can typically provide recommendations to trustworthy mental health professionals.
Inspect Credentials: Once you have a list of prospective suppliers, examine their credentials through regional licensing boards to ensure they are certified and have tidy disciplinary records.
Read Reviews: Online reviews on platforms like Yelp or Google can provide insight into the experiences of previous clients. Nevertheless, bear in mind that experiences can differ extensively.
Insurance coverage Coverage: If you have medical insurance, describe your strategy to see if it covers any private mental health services. Some practitioners may provide moving scale charges for those without insurance.
Set up Consultations: Many specialists use introductory consultations. Use this chance to evaluate whether their approach resonates with you.

Q1: How much does a private mental health diagnosis cost?
The cost of private mental health diagnostics varies widely based upon the supplier, area, and particular services used. Typically, preliminary examinations can range from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500, while ongoing sessions might range from ₤ 75 to ₤ 250.
Q2: How long does it require to get a diagnosis?
The time required for a diagnosis can differ based upon the complexity of the case and the service provider's method. Some examinations may take one session, while others could require multiple visits over numerous weeks.
Q3: Do I require a recommendation for a private mental health diagnosis?
For the most part, you do not require a referral to look for care from a private mental health supplier. Nevertheless, talk to your health insurance coverage strategy if you plan to use insurance coverage to cover expenses.
Q4: What should I anticipate throughout my very first visit?
Your first consultation generally includes an intake assessment, where the service provider will ask concerns about your mental and physical health history, present symptoms, and any previous treatments.
